Transaction 6b29203fa37a707e36261055ba767e24f5b9694f85b47b898ade88db1d7a080a
1 Input
1 Output
-
6b29203fa37a707e36261055ba767e24f5b9694f85b47b898ade88db1d7a080a:0
- value
- 6870514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6a21444cda208b837df7bd1636878a907f692b2 OP_EQUAL
- address
- 3MFth45mjFyfZhBrrwFa7qzJNRDtZRVtRm